Carl Benjamin, also known as Sargon of Akkad, is a prominent YouTuber and founder of lotuseaters.com, celebrated for his insights on politics and culture. He dives into the erosion of civil liberties during crises like COVID-19 and critiques government overreach. Benjamin discusses the tangled web of immigration and housing issues, questioning current policies and proposing alternatives. He also tackles the ethics surrounding immigration and the need for a deeper understanding of happiness beyond materialism, while emphasizing the importance of freedom of speech in the age of big tech censorship.
